[Pidgin] #4382: Update to MSNP15

Pidgin trac at pidgin.im
Wed Dec 12 21:34:19 EST 2007


#4382: Update to MSNP15
--------------------+-------------------------------------------------------
Reporter:  QuLogic  |       Owner:  khc                            
    Type:  patch    |      Status:  new                            
Priority:  minor    |   Component:  MSN                            
 Version:  2.3.1    |    Keywords:  MSNP15, ticket tokens, RPS, SSO
 Pending:  0        |  
--------------------+-------------------------------------------------------
 So khc wanted to take a look at the MSNP15 stuff, so I'm posting these
 tickets.

 These patches add support for logging in with MSNP15.

 The first patch changes some miscellaneous items to refer to MSNP15
 instead of MSNP13. It updates the requested protocol version, as well as
 the challenge responses.

 The second patch adds RPS/SSO authentication to login. It depends on the
 Triple-DES cipher and HMAC digest in tickets #4380 and #4381. There's not
 much else to say about that.

 Finally, the third patch updates the contact SOAP operations to use Ticket
 Tokens instead of MSPAuth. I guess this isn't strictly necessary, but
 without it there'd be nothing in your buddy list. While I was at it, I
 also reformatted contact.h so the XML looks nicer.

 What's tested:
  * Signing in/out
  * Adding/removing buddies
  * Moving buddies between groups
  * Adding groups
   * If I try to move a buddy to a new group, the group is created, but
 then when moving the buddy, the group name seems to be forgotten. I
 haven't had time to check what's wrong here.

 Not tested:
  * Anything with Yahoo! buddies

-- 
Ticket URL: <http://developer.pidgin.im/ticket/4382>
Pidgin <http://pidgin.im>
Pidgin


More information about the Tracker mailing list